18 /*
19  * This struct is used to associate PCI Function of MAC controller on a board,
20  * discovered via DMI, with the address of PHY connected to the MAC. The
21  * negative value of the address means that MAC controller is not connected
22  * with PHY.
23  */
24 struct stmmac_pci_func_data {
25 	unsigned int func;
26 	int phy_addr;
27 };
28 
29 struct stmmac_pci_dmi_data {
30 	const struct stmmac_pci_func_data *func;
31 	size_t nfuncs;
32 };
33 
34 struct stmmac_pci_info {
35 	int (*setup)(struct pci_dev *pdev, struct plat_stmmacenet_data *plat);
36 };
37 
38 static int stmmac_pci_find_phy_addr(struct pci_dev *pdev,
39 				    const struct dmi_system_id *dmi_list)
40 {
41 	const struct stmmac_pci_func_data *func_data;
42 	const struct stmmac_pci_dmi_data *dmi_data;
43 	const struct dmi_system_id *dmi_id;
44 	int func = PCI_FUNC(pdev->devfn);
45 	size_t n;
46 
47 	dmi_id = dmi_first_match(dmi_list);
48 	if (!dmi_id)
49 		return -ENODEV;
50 
51 	dmi_data = dmi_id->driver_data;
52 	func_data = dmi_data->func;
53 
54 	for (n = 0; n < dmi_data->nfuncs; n++, func_data++)
55 		if (func_data->func == func)
56 			return func_data->phy_addr;
57 
58 	return -ENODEV;
59 }

335 static int quark_default_data(struct pci_dev *pdev,
336 			      struct plat_stmmacenet_data *plat)
337 {
338 	int ret;
339 
340 	/* Set common default data first */
341 	common_default_data(plat);
342 
343 	/*
344 	 * Refuse to load the driver and register net device if MAC controller
345 	 * does not connect to any PHY interface.
346 	 */
347 	ret = stmmac_pci_find_phy_addr(pdev, quark_pci_dmi);
348 	if (ret < 0) {
349 		/* Return error to the caller on DMI enabled boards. */
350 		if (dmi_get_system_info(DMI_BOARD_NAME))
351 			return ret;
352 
353 		/*
354 		 * Galileo boards with old firmware don't support DMI. We always
355 		 * use 1 here as PHY address, so at least the first found MAC
356 		 * controller would be probed.
357 		 */
358 		ret = 1;
359 	}
360 
361 	plat->bus_id = pci_dev_id(pdev);
362 	plat->phy_addr = ret;
363 	plat->phy_interface = PHY_INTERFACE_MODE_RMII;
364 
365 	plat->dma_cfg->pbl = 16;
366 	plat->dma_cfg->pblx8 = true;
367 	plat->dma_cfg->fixed_burst = 1;
368 	/* AXI (TODO) */
369 
370 	return 0;
371 }

446 /**
447  * stmmac_pci_probe
448  *
449  * @pdev: pci device pointer
450  * @id: pointer to table of device id/id's.
451  *
452  * Description: This probing function gets called for all PCI devices which
453  * match the ID table and are not "owned" by other driver yet. This function
454  * gets passed a "struct pci_dev *" for each device whose entry in the ID table
455  * matches the device. The probe functions returns zero when the driver choose
456  * to take "ownership" of the device or an error code(-ve no) otherwise.
457  */
458 static int stmmac_pci_probe(struct pci_dev *pdev,
459 			    const struct pci_device_id *id)
460 {
461 	struct stmmac_pci_info *info = (struct stmmac_pci_info *)id->driver_data;
462 	struct plat_stmmacenet_data *plat;
463 	struct stmmac_resources res;
464 	int i;
465 	int ret;
466 
467 	plat = devm_kzalloc(&pdev->dev, sizeof(*plat), GFP_KERNEL);
468 	if (!plat)
469 		return -ENOMEM;
470 
471 	plat->mdio_bus_data = devm_kzalloc(&pdev->dev,
472 					   sizeof(*plat->mdio_bus_data),
473 					   GFP_KERNEL);
474 	if (!plat->mdio_bus_data)
475 		return -ENOMEM;
476 
477 	plat->dma_cfg = devm_kzalloc(&pdev->dev, sizeof(*plat->dma_cfg),
478 				     GFP_KERNEL);
479 	if (!plat->dma_cfg)
480 		return -ENOMEM;
481 
482 	/* Enable pci device */
483 	ret = pci_enable_device(pdev);
484 	if (ret) {
485 		dev_err(&pdev->dev, "%s: ERROR: failed to enable device\n",
486 			__func__);
487 		return ret;
488 	}
489 
490 	/* Get the base address of device */
491 	for (i = 0; i < PCI_STD_NUM_BARS; i++) {
492 		if (pci_resource_len(pdev, i) == 0)
493 			continue;
494 		ret = pcim_iomap_regions(pdev, BIT(i), pci_name(pdev));
495 		if (ret)
496 			return ret;
497 		break;
498 	}
499 
500 	pci_set_master(pdev);
501 
502 	ret = info->setup(pdev, plat);
503 	if (ret)
504 		return ret;
505 
506 	pci_enable_msi(pdev);
507 
508 	memset(&res, 0, sizeof(res));
509 	res.addr = pcim_iomap_table(pdev)[i];
510 	res.wol_irq = pdev->irq;
511 	res.irq = pdev->irq;
512 
513 	return stmmac_dvr_probe(&pdev->dev, plat, &res);
514 }
